ZIP Code 64113

ZIP / ZCTA

Population: 12,442

ZIP Code Tabulation Areas (ZCTAs) are Census approximations of USPS ZIP codes. Boundaries may differ slightly from postal delivery areas, and estimates for less-populated ZCTAs carry higher margins of error.

Data: U.S. Census Bureau, ACS 5-Year Estimates, 2023 (released December 2024).

Quick Facts — 64113

What is the median household income in 64113?
The median household income in 64113 is $179,593 (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 5-Year Estimates, 2023).
What is the poverty rate in 64113?
The poverty rate in 64113 is 1.6% (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2023).
What is the median home value in 64113?
$483,600 (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2023).
What is the average rent in 64113?
The median gross rent in 64113 is $2,307 per month (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2023).
What percentage of 64113 residents have a college degree?
87.7% of adults in 64113 hold a bachelor's degree or higher (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2023).
